Abstract
The published safety policy of Mount Isa Mines Limited, together with details of the  organisation and control techniques adopted by  management to pursue an active safety  programme within the company, is presented.  The importance of communication by management  through the organisational hierarchy and  procedures instituted to ensure rapid and  concise feedback on safety concerns are  detailed. The paper also describes the role  of the occupational health department and  safety committees in assisting management to  monitor the safety effort of supervisors and  employees. Current safety performance levels are  tabled together with details of some aspects  of the programme on which safety effort will  be concentrated in the future.
